School Counsellor - Full Time (5 Days per Week)
Location: Southwark, London

We are seeking a compassionate, experienced, and knowledgeable School Counsellor to join a welcoming and supportive school in Southwark on a full-time basis.

This is an excellent opportunity for a dedicated professional with previous counselling experience in an educational or similar setting. A relevant degree is preferred, alongside a strong understanding of child and adolescent mental health, safeguarding, and therapeutic approaches.

Our school offers a warm, inclusive environment where staff are valued, supported, and encouraged to develop professionally, with excellent opportunities for growth and career progression.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Provide one-to-one counselling and emotional support to students.
  • Counselling qualifications / certificates are mandatory
  • Assess students' wellbeing and develop appropriate support plans.
  • Work collaboratively with staff, parents, and external agencies to promote positive outcomes.
  • Maintain accurate, confidential records in line with safeguarding and GDPR requirements.
  • Contribute to the school's wellbeing strategy and promote positive mental health across the school.
